Colorado's Unit 15 stacks timbered Gore Pass benches above the deep Colorado River breaks near Radium and State Bridge, and for bear that vertical layering is everything: the mid-elevation Gambel oak, serviceberry, and bitterbrush belt (roughly 7,500 to 9,000 feet) is a browse-and-mast pantry, while water stays reliable up high and turns scarce in the dry pinyon-juniper canyons below.
